Joane Young 1555 – 1615 – Genealogical Records

Birth Date: 1555

Birth Location: West Sussex, England

Death Date: 1615

Death Location: Shipdham, Breckland Borough, Norfolk, England

Father: Anthony Young

Mother: Mary None

Spouse(s): Thomas Vines

Children(s): Thomas Vines

Joane Young was born in 1555 in West Sussex, England, the child of Anthony Young and Mary. Joane Young married Thomas Vines, and had children including Thomas William Vines. Joane Young passed away in 1615 in Shipdham, Breckland Borough, Norfolk, England.
